when does the life of a star begin? correct answerswhen a diffuse area of a spinning
nebula begins to shrink and heat up under the influence of its own weak gravity.
Gradually, the cloud like sphere flattens and condenses at the center into a knot of
gases called a protostar. The original diameter of the protostar may be many times the
diameter of our solar system, but gravitational energy causes it to contract, and the
compression raises its internal temperature. When the protostar reaches a temperature
of about 10 million degrees Celsius (18 million degrees Fahrenheit), nuclear fusion
begins. That is, hydrogen atoms begin to fuse to form helium, a process that liberates
even more energy. This rapid release of energy, which marks the transition from
protostar to star, stops the young star's shrinkage.
when does the dying phase of a massive star's life begin? correct answerswhen its core
—depleted of hydrogen—collapses in on itself. This rapid compression causes the star's
internal temperature to soar. When the in falling material can no longer be compressed,
the energy of the inward fall is converted to a cataclysmic expansion called a supernova
(nova, "new" [star]). The explosive release of energy in a supernova is so sudden that
the star is blown to bits, and its shattered mass accelerates outward at nearly the speed
of light. The explosion lasts only about 30 seconds, but in that short time the nuclear
forces holding apart individual atomic nuclei are overcome, and atoms heavier than iron
are formed. The gold in your rings, the mercury in a thermometer, and the uranium in
nuclear power plants were all created during such a brief and stupendous flash. The
atoms produced by a star through millions of years of orderly fusion and the heavy
atoms generated in a few moments of unimaginable chaos are sprayed into space
Every chemical element heavier than hydrogen—most of the atoms that make up the
planets, the ocean, and living creatures—was manufactured by the stars.
